1. Consider the Size

The size of the wheel rims is an essential factor to consider. It not only affects the appearance of your vehicle but also influences its performance. Larger wheel rims can provide a more aggressive and sporty look, while smaller ones can offer better fuel efficiency and a smoother ride. However, it’s crucial to strike a balance between aesthetics and functionality.

Here are a few things to keep in mind:

  • Check your vehicle’s manufacturer guidelines for the recommended wheel rim sizes.
  • Consider the tire size that will be compatible with the chosen wheel rims.
  • Ensure that the wheel rims fit properly within the wheel well without interfering with the suspension or braking system.

2. Material Matters

The material of the wheel rims plays a significant role in their durability, weight, and overall performance. Here are some common materials used for wheel rims:

  • Steel: Steel rims are affordable and durable, making them a popular choice for budget-conscious buyers. However, they tend to be heavier and may affect fuel efficiency.
  • Aluminum Alloy: Aluminum alloy rims are lightweight and offer better heat dissipation, resulting in improved braking performance. They are also available in a wide range of designs and finishes.
  • Carbon Fiber: Carbon fiber rims are the epitome of performance and style. They are incredibly lightweight, providing enhanced acceleration and handling. However, they are also the most expensive option.

3. Consider the Finish

The finish of the wheel rims can significantly impact the overall look of your vehicle. It’s essential to choose a finish that complements your car’s color and style. Some popular finishes include:

  • Chrome: Chrome finishes offer a shiny and reflective surface, adding a touch of luxury to your vehicle.
  • Painted: Painted finishes provide a wide range of color options, allowing you to match your car’s paint or create a contrasting effect.
  • Polished: Polished finishes offer a mirror-like shine, giving your vehicle a sleek and sophisticated appearance.
  • Machined: Machined finishes combine polished and painted elements, creating a unique and eye-catching look.

4. Budget Considerations

Before making a final decision, it’s crucial to consider your budget. Wheel rims are available in a wide price range, depending on the material, brand, and design. While it’s tempting to opt for the most expensive option, it’s essential to find a balance between quality and affordability.

Consider the long-term value of the wheel rims, including their durability and maintenance requirements. Investing in high-quality rims may save you money in the long run by reducing the need for frequent replacements or repairs.
